socage
About Our Definitions: All forms of a word (noun, verb, etc.) are now displayed on one page.


so·cage

noun \ˈsä-kij, ˈsō-\

Definition of SOCAGE

: a tenure of land by agricultural service fixed in amount and kind or by payment of money rent only and not burdened with any military service
so·cag·er \-ki-jər\ noun

Variants of SOCAGE

so·cage also soc·cage \ˈsä-\

Origin of SOCAGE

Middle English, from Anglo-French, from soc soke
First Known Use: 14th century
